编程那点事编程那点事

专注编程入门及提高
探究程序员职业规划之道!

StringBuffer类

public class Main {
    public static void main(String[] args) {
        // 在sb尾部追加一个字符串
        StringBuffer sb = new StringBuffer("Hello ");
        sb.append("world");
        System.out.println(sb.toString());
        // 返回下标为1的字符
        StringBuffer sb = new StringBuffer("Hello ");
        sb.charAt(1);
        System.out.println(sb.toString());
        // 在 1 处插入新的字符串 d
        StringBuffer sb = new StringBuffer("Hello ");
        sb.insert(1, "d");
        System.out.println(sb.toString());
        // 反转字符
        StringBuffer sb = new StringBuffer("Hello ");
        sb.reverse();
        System.out.println(sb.toString());
        // 删除字符串
        StringBuffer sb = new StringBuffer("Hello ");
        sb.delete(1, 2);
        System.out.println(sb.toString());
        // 替换字符串  从 3开始到4结束
        StringBuffer sb = new StringBuffer("Hello ");
        sb.replace(3, 4, "new");
        System.out.println(sb.toString());
    }
}


未经允许不得转载: 技术文章 » Java编程 » StringBuffer类